MediaWiki  1.29.2
pruneFileCache.php
Go to the documentation of this file.
1 <?php
24 require_once __DIR__ . '/Maintenance.php';
25 
31 class PruneFileCache extends Maintenance {
32 
34 
35  public function __construct() {
36  parent::__construct();
37  $this->addDescription( 'Build file cache for content pages' );
38  $this->addOption( 'agedays', 'How many days old files must be in order to delete', true, true );
39  $this->addOption( 'subdir', 'Prune one $wgFileCacheDirectory subdirectory name', false, true );
40  }
41 
42  public function execute() {
44 
45  if ( !$wgUseFileCache ) {
46  $this->error( "Nothing to do -- \$wgUseFileCache is disabled.", true );
47  }
48 
49  $age = $this->getOption( 'agedays' );
50  if ( !ctype_digit( $age ) ) {
51  $this->error( "Non-integer 'age' parameter given.", true );
52  }
53  // Delete items with a TS older than this
54  $this->minSurviveTimestamp = time() - ( 86400 * $age );
55 
57  if ( !is_dir( $dir ) ) {
58  $this->error( "Nothing to do -- \$wgFileCacheDirectory directory not found.", true );
59  }
60 
61  $subDir = $this->getOption( 'subdir' );
62  if ( $subDir !== null ) {
63  if ( !is_dir( "$dir/$subDir" ) ) {
64  $this->error( "The specified subdirectory `$subDir` does not exist.", true );
65  }
66  $this->output( "Pruning `$dir/$subDir` directory...\n" );
67  $this->prune_directory( "$dir/$subDir", 'report' );
68  $this->output( "Done pruning `$dir/$subDir` directory\n" );
69  } else {
70  $this->output( "Pruning `$dir` directory...\n" );
71  // Note: don't prune things like .cdb files on the top level!
72  $this->prune_directory( $dir, 'report' );
73  $this->output( "Done pruning `$dir` directory\n" );
74  }
75  }
76 
81  protected function prune_directory( $dir, $report = false ) {
82  $tsNow = time();
83  $dirHandle = opendir( $dir );
84  while ( false !== ( $file = readdir( $dirHandle ) ) ) {
85  // Skip ".", "..", and also any dirs or files like ".svn" or ".htaccess"
86  if ( $file[0] != "." ) {
87  $path = $dir . '/' . $file; // absolute
88  if ( is_dir( $path ) ) {
89  if ( $report === 'report' ) {
90  $this->output( "Scanning `$path`...\n" );
91  }
92  $this->prune_directory( $path );
93  } else {
94  $mts = filemtime( $path );
95  // Sanity check the file extension against known cache types
96  if ( $mts < $this->minSurviveTimestamp
97  && preg_match( '/\.(?:html|cache)(?:\.gz)?$/', $file )
98  && unlink( $path )
99  ) {
100  $daysOld = round( ( $tsNow - $mts ) / 86400, 2 );
101  $this->output( "Deleted `$path` [days=$daysOld]\n" );
102  }
103  }
104  }
105  }
106  closedir( $dirHandle );
107  }
108 }
109 
110 $maintClass = "PruneFileCache";
111 require_once RUN_MAINTENANCE_IF_MAIN;
